Where is the Ronacher family from?

You can see how Ronacher families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Ronacher family name was found in the USA, and the UK between 1880 and 1920. The most Ronacher families were found in US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 4 Ronacher families living in Indiana. This was 100% of all the recorded Ronacher's in USA. Indiana had the highest population of Ronacher families in 1880.

What is the average Ronacher lifespan?

Between 1969 and 2004, in the United States, Ronacher life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1981, and highest in 1999. The average life expectancy for Ronacher in 1969 was 51, and 85 in 2004.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Ronacher 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
